With all this talk about opera right now, I thought Iβd bring back this piece I did years ago on Evelyn Mandac, the first Filipino to ever sing at the Metropolitan Opera House. It took me years to track her down, I still find myself thinking back on her inspiring story www.kexp.org/read/2021/5/...

Hiro Ama Creates Peace with a 1980s Japanese Synthesizer
YouTube video by KEXP Podcasts
Had the chance not long ago to speak with Hiro Ama about his beautiful album Music for Peace & Harmony. We talked about what βpeace and harmonyβ means during chaotic times, and he gave me a demonstration of the Waraku synthesizer for KEXP's A Deeper Listen podcast www.youtube.com/watch?v=Ojoa...

Talked with Gregg Deal from Dead Pioneers, one of my favorite punk bands in recent years, about disillusionment with the American dream, Indigenous representation in media, and their great new album PO$T AMERICAN. Listen here: kexp.org/podcasts/a-d...
